Output 58c9450f8ddbdc5e2d01d67e386c2e11b7dbf9f0d16a258200b7d80951e06caa:0

value
76434655
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ce337c36b66adbe176aab0d914ad8766a8041730 OP_EQUALVERIFY OP_CHECKSIG
address
1KoHsmnYiCvMnnADz5BYnZBx5WEymcKzL6
transaction
58c9450f8ddbdc5e2d01d67e386c2e11b7dbf9f0d16a258200b7d80951e06caa
spent
true